How can I create a spreadsheet in Google Sheets?
- Open your Google account and go to Google Drive.
- Click the “+ New” button and select “Spreadsheet.”
- Give your spreadsheet a name and start entering your data.
- Use Google Sheets features to perform calculations and data analysis.
- Save your spreadsheet to Google Drive for anytime access and editing.

What is the difference between Google Sheets and Excel?
- Google Sheets is a web-based application that runs in the browser, while Excel is a desktop spreadsheet program.
- Google Sheets is accessible from any device with an internet connection, while Excel requires installation on a specific device.
- Both tools have similar functions for calculating, analyzing and visualizing data, but they differ in their interface and collaboration capabilities.
Is Google Sheets free?
- Yes, Google Sheets is completely free for users with a Google account.
- You don't have to pay for a subscription or purchase a license to access and use Google Sheets.
- However, Google offers a premium version called Google Workspace with additional features for businesses and organizations.

How can I share a spreadsheet in Google Sheets with other users?
- Open your spreadsheet in Google Sheets.
- Click the "Share" button in the top right corner of the screen.
- Enter the email address of the person you want to share the spreadsheet with.
- Select the editing, commenting, or viewing permissions you want to grant.
- Click “Send” to share the spreadsheet with others.
